Understanding Your Audience

Before you can make effective tweaks, it’s essential to understand your audience. Who are they? What are their interests, pain points, and preferences? Conducting thorough audience research through surveys, social media interactions, and analytics can provide valuable insights. This foundational knowledge will allow you to shape your content in a way that resonates deeply, fostering connection and engagement.

The Art of Customization

  1. Language and Tone: The language you use should resonate with your audience. A casual, playful tone might work well for a young, vibrant demographic, whereas a formal, authoritative tone might be more appropriate for a professional audience. Tweaking your vocabulary, sentence structure, and overall tone can make your communication feel more personalized and relevant.

  2. Cultural Relevance: Tailoring content to reflect the cultural nuances and values of your audience can significantly enhance connection. Consider current events, popular culture references, or community-specific issues that may resonate. This type of customization demonstrates that you understand and respect your audience’s background and experiences.

  3. Visual Elements: Visual content plays a crucial role in engagement. Ensure that images, colors, and layouts are appealing to your audience. For instance, younger audiences might prefer bold graphics and dynamic visuals, while older demographics may appreciate a cleaner, more straightforward design.

  4. Content Format: Different audiences consume content in various formats. Some may prefer blog posts; others might engage better with video content or infographics. Assessing the preferences of your audience can help you choose the right format and optimize your message delivery.

Engaging Interactivity

Encouraging interaction can also make your content more relatable. Consider incorporating polls, quizzes, or comment sections where your audience can express their opinions or share experiences. This interactive element not only engages your audience but allows for further customization based on their feedback.

Iterative Process

Customization is not a one-time event; it requires an iterative approach. Regularly revisit your strategies to assess what resonates with your audience. Data analytics can help track engagement metrics, providing concrete evidence of what’s working and what isn’t. Be open to making continuous adjustments based on these insights.

The Power of Authenticity

As you tweak your content, authenticity should remain at the forefront. Audiences are quick to spot insincerity; therefore, ensure that your messages align with your brand’s values and mission. Authentic content fosters trust and loyalty, creating a long-term relationship with your audience.
